Swine flu claimed 42 lives in T’gana since Jan 11

As many as 42 persons have succumbed to swine flu and related complications while 831 people tested positive for the H1N1 virus in Telangana between January 1 and February 8 this year.

“In the current year, from January 1 till February 8, 2,542 samples have been tested, out of which 831 found to be positive and number of deaths because of other complications and swine flu are 42,” a bulletin on swine flu issue   d by the state government said on Monday.

It said 99 samples were tested on Sunday and 33 have been found to be positive for the virus.
The number of positive cases reported in the last six days (up to February 8) is showing a decline in intensity.

“The figures are 18, 32, 20, 30 and 33,” it said.

However, the citizens have been advised to take precautions and must report to a hospital on the first symptoms of swine flu, like high fever, sneezing, cough and body pains, it said. Enough stock of medicines are available at all teaching hospitals, district hospitals and area hospitals, the bulletin said, adding, there are enough testing kits and kits for Viral Transport Medium (VTM).
